001:        package com.bostechcorp.cbesb.runtime.component.email.processors;
002:
003:        import com.bostechcorp.cbesb.runtime.ccsl.jbi.messaging.IConsumerHandlerContext;
004:
005:        public class EmailConsumerHandlerContext implements 
006:                IConsumerHandlerContext {
007:            //	 Message Metadata
008:            private String from = "";
009:            private String to = "";
010:            private String cc = "";
011:            private String sent = "";
012:            private String received = "";
013:            private String subject = "";
014:            private String attachment = "";
015:
016:            /**
017:             * @return the attachment
018:             */
019:            public String getAttachment() {
020:                return attachment;
021:            }
022:
023:            /**
024:             * @param attachment the attachment to set
025:             */
026:            public void setAttachment(String attachment) {
027:                this .attachment = attachment;
028:            }
029:
030:            /**
031:             * @return the cc
032:             */
033:            public String getCc() {
034:                return cc;
035:            }
036:
037:            /**
038:             * @param cc the cc to set
039:             */
040:            public void setCc(String cc) {
041:                this .cc = cc;
042:            }
043:
044:            /**
045:             * @return the from
046:             */
047:            public String getFrom() {
048:                return from;
049:            }
050:
051:            /**
052:             * @param from the from to set
053:             */
054:            public void setFrom(String from) {
055:                this .from = from;
056:            }
057:
058:            /**
059:             * @return the received
060:             */
061:            public String getReceived() {
062:                return received;
063:            }
064:
065:            /**
066:             * @param received the received to set
067:             */
068:            public void setReceived(String received) {
069:                this .received = received;
070:            }
071:
072:            /**
073:             * @return the sent
074:             */
075:            public String getSent() {
076:                return sent;
077:            }
078:
079:            /**
080:             * @param sent the sent to set
081:             */
082:            public void setSent(String sent) {
083:                this .sent = sent;
084:            }
085:
086:            /**
087:             * @return the subject
088:             */
089:            public String getSubject() {
090:                return subject;
091:            }
092:
093:            /**
094:             * @param subject the subject to set
095:             */
096:            public void setSubject(String subject) {
097:                this .subject = subject;
098:            }
099:
100:            /**
101:             * @return the to
102:             */
103:            public String getTo() {
104:                return to;
105:            }
106:
107:            /**
108:             * @param to the to to set
109:             */
110:            public void setTo(String to) {
111:                this.to = to;
112:            }
113:
114:        }
